服务器端编程:语法精要与代码优化实战
|
服务器端编程是构建高效、稳定后端服务的核心,掌握其语法精要与代码优化技巧至关重要。无论是使用Java、Python还是Go语言,理解基础语法结构和数据类型都是第一步。 在编写代码时,应注重逻辑清晰,避免冗余操作。例如,在处理HTTP请求时,合理使用中间件可以提升性能,同时保持代码的可维护性。变量命名应具有描述性,使其他开发者能够快速理解代码意图。 代码优化不仅仅是提高执行速度,更包括资源管理与内存使用。减少不必要的对象创建、合理使用缓存机制,都能显著提升系统响应能力。同时,避免过度嵌套的条件判断,有助于降低复杂度。 日志记录是调试与监控的关键工具,但需注意不要过度输出信息。采用分级日志策略,如DEBUG、INFO、ERROR,可以在不影响性能的前提下提供足够的调试信息。 测试驱动开发(TDD)是一种值得推广的实践。通过编写单元测试和集成测试,确保代码的健壮性。自动化测试框架的使用能大幅减少人为错误,提高整体质量。 在部署过程中,配置管理应尽量做到环境隔离。使用环境变量或配置文件区分不同部署环境,避免硬编码导致的潜在问题。同时,监控与告警系统的建立也是保障服务稳定的重要环节。
本图由AI生成,仅供参考 持续学习与实践是提升技能的关键。关注社区动态,参与开源项目,不断积累经验,才能在实际工作中游刃有余。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

